Why Phone Number Verification Matters

Phone numbers are more than just contact details they’re often used as identifiers and authentication keys. For developers building apps, and for businesses handling customer data, collecting invalid or fake numbers causes operational inefficiencies, marketing losses, and even security risks.

A verify phone number API checks the syntax, format, and legitimacy of a phone number. But it doesn’t stop there when integrated with a phone carrier lookup API, you gain access to network-level details like carrier name, line type (mobile, landline, VoIP), and ported status.

What is a Verify Phone Number API?

A phone number verification API allows your application to instantly check whether a number is valid, formatted correctly, and live. It checks country codes, line types, and more. Developers use this to prevent fake signups, reduce bounced SMS messages, and increase user trust.

Key Benefits:

  • Real-time number validation

  • Country and region identification

  • Line type detection (mobile, landline, VoIP)

When used on websites or mobile apps, this API filters out incorrect inputs and enhances your user data quality.

What is a Phone Carrier Lookup API?

The phone carrier lookup API is designed to pull carrier level information behind any given phone number. It helps determine:

  • The telecom provider (Verizon, AT&T, etc.)

  • The original or current carrier (in case of number porting)

  • Whether the number belongs to a mobile or landline device

This data is useful for call routing, SMS delivery optimization, fraud detection, and compliance with carrier-specific messaging rules.

How Developers Can Integrate These APIs

Most modern phone validation tools offer REST-based APIs. Here’s how a typical integration might work:

  1. Send a request with the phone number and country code.

  2. Receive a response containing validation status, carrier name, line type, and more.

  3. Act accordingly for example, reject fake signups, tailor SMS delivery, or block VoIP registrations.

Ideal Use Cases for Small Businesses

1. Marketing Campaigns: Avoid wasting SMS credits by only messaging real, active numbers.

2. Signup Validation: Prevent spam and bot signups by validating phone numbers in real time.

3. CRM Clean-up: Enrich your customer database by verifying and labeling phone numbers accurately.

4. Support Routing: Identify carrier and line type to optimize call handling.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

1. What’s the difference between phone number validation and carrier lookup?

Phone number validation checks whether the number is correctly formatted and exists, while carrier lookup reveals the telecom provider and line type behind the number.
